Google's Go belooft snelle tijden compileren en is ontworpen voor multithreaded applicatie-ontwikkeling.
Volgens een artikel over op ExtremeTech, - de nieuwe taal genaamd 'Go' - kwam toen het bedrijf besloten dat het nodig is een gestroomlijnde, eenvoudige methode voor het maken van servers en andere projecten voor intern gebruik. Hoewel ontworpen voor eigen gebruik van Google, is de taal beschikbaar gesteld onder een open-source licentie - wat betekent dat het is gratis voor iedereen uit te voeren voor welk doel dan ook.
De officiële website - die zelf draait op een webserver geschreven in Go - legt uit dat de taal die is ontworpen om eenvoudig, snel, en combineren de voordelen van uitgelegd - waar de code wordt uitgevoerd, zoals vereist - en samengesteld - waar de code is veranderd in een direct uitvoerbaar formaat - talen. Met ontworpen ondersteuning voor multithreaded systemen, garbage collection een robuust systeem, en een indrukwekkend snelle compiler, het is een taal die zeker is van belang heel wat in de programmering gemeenschap.
Inderdaad, de snelheid waarschijnlijk de grootste attractie voor veel: een video introductie van het systeem blijkt ongeveer duizend regels code compileren van Go in ongeveer tweehonderd milliseconden op een gemiddelde desktop machine - het testen van veranderingen een stuk minder pijnlijk dan bij traditionele gecompileerde taal.
Voor diegenen die geïnteresseerd zijn in het uitproberen Go, Google heeft een tutorial sectie op de officiële site, samen met een niet-onaanzienlijke bedrag van monster code voor het spelen met.
Bent u van mening dat Google's Go de toekomst van de programmering zou kunnen betekenen, of is het waarschijnlijk niet meer dan een leuke afleiding voor degenen onder hen die echte object-georiënteerde systemen een beetje verwarrend? Deel uw gedachten over in de forums.
Hiç yorum yok:
Yorum Gönder